Topps recalls contaminated meat that possibly sickened 21

On Wednesday,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ention announced that 21 people across 8 states may have been sickened to due possibly contaminated ground beef sold by Topps Meat Company. The New Jersey-based company issued a recall for meat that is possibly contaminated with E. coli bacteria including 331,582 pounds of frozen beef patties and 21 of its products that have been distributed across the country. Out of the 21 reported cases, three have been confirmed as caused by the company’s beef. These include two in New York and one in Florida. The other cases are currently being investigated.
